Gareth refusing to Bale on Spurs as defender eyes a run in Harry's team

06 January 2010 12:40
Good to be back: Bale[LNB]Gareth Bale is determined to establish himself in the Tottenham team.[LNB]Bale looked to be heading out of White Hart Lane as Benoit Assou-Ekotto made the left-back position his own.[LNB]But with the Cameroon star sidelined with a groin injury, Bale made his third start of the season in the FA Cup victory over Peterborough and the 20-year-old Welshman is determined to build on his performance and give boss Harry Redknapp plenty to think about.[LNB]He said: 'We've all been working hard in training to keep our fitness levels up so when we do come into the team, we're able to cope.
